MPE 3 mths and 2800mi update

To help others with questions concerning the MPE here is my update

Now after having the MPE since Dec (3 mths & 2800 mi) and doing a hard hi speed mountain road runs here are my current comments.

Note: I have V2 with the exit pipe braces and slip over attaching interface.

The exhaust is awesome..... the way a BMW track car should sound. Not too loud and obnoxious....just right

Cost for me was reasonable since I didn't have to purchase tips. I purchased the exhaust from Sun Motorcars and had tips from previous F82

I run it in either sport with flaps open or comfort with flaps closed, why?

*Cuz when you run flaps open and in comfort for some reason there is more resonating thru the car at below 3500 rpm then there is with flaps open. Why, i have no friggin idea. You would think it is the other way around.

My car has the most pops/burbles in flaps open & sport, way more then in MDM & flaps open contrary what others are saying.

The fit was perfect the first time, install straight forward

The exhaust makes a little bit of HP proven with my dyno results 3-7hp aprox

The water drain hole in the bottom leaves a black trail up the back of the polished can FYI

Mine still has awful cold start vibration, but am used to it after having the F82 & MPE

My bluetooth connection has been working fine so far and has not dropped. I did do the install myself so know how it was put together

Ok so an update to my update....

So as you know I have the resonating cold start noise. I started playing around with some things to try and lesson the cold start resonation. I tried pulling the exhaust back a bit to load the rubber hangers differently and left it over night to get a true cold start. Still the same, but I moved it back too far and upon full temp and exhaust expansion it touched heat shielding. Then I tried moving it far as possible forward...still the same on full cold start. So it is not caused by design of the hanging points and as you know the exhaust also has a flex joint after the down piped so that should also help dampen any vibration.

Well I remember someone commenting awhile back somewhere on here or the M4 forum about taking the tips off and trying it, I have the carbon-Ti tips. Well I took them off and it still vibrates but without the rattle resonating noise. It is a quiet vibration. So all this time with the F82 MPE and now the F87 MPE ( I have the same tips) the exhausts have always vibrated but the noise..... is being created with my M carbon titanium tips.

Interesting..... I still love it

So here's your answer for the drone at 3K RPM in comfort but not sport.

In sport/sport+ modes the DME asks the EWG ( electronic wastegate ) to be closed, or at 99.99% Duty cycle until it needs to vent boost, this is for quicker spool times, vs when in comfort it's open until X amount of throttle input.

When the EWG is closed it means less exhaust flow through the pipes as it's being absorbed by the turbine wheels, thus producing what we like to call BOOOOOOOOOOST. That's why it's quieter

The tips have a set screw under the bottom, you slide them forward or back on the exhaust outlets independently of the actual exhaust.

Not if you have Ver 2 of the exhaust the attaching point on the stock pipe has a slip over joint and I tried pulling it back then pushing it forward to change the load on the hanger rubbers bit it was useless. To align your tips just slide them forward or back then re-tighten the set screw

Not sure what MR_M2 is referencing in his comment whether it was the actual exhaust they slid in to the tips. If the physically pushed the exhaust forward 3in then it would be against the forward wall so it might be the tips

Oct 2017 you should have Ver 2. There should be a bracket between the exit pipes on each side. Something that looks like a clamp that keeps then from vibrating, with a tightening screw in the middle. The slip joint is um just past the tunnel cross brace. You can see it if you look under the car...there is a clamp
